“In fact, there has been a misunderstanding in the restoration industry, which confuses several types of paper.”

"There is a kind of paper produced in Jingchuan, called 'Taishi paper'. Taishi paper is paper with rough edges and is slightly yellow in color;"

"And Lianshi paper is also known as 'Lian Si paper' and 'Lian Si paper', where it is produced In Liancheng, Fujian, it is a kind of white paper with fiber. It has fine texture, uniform thickness, white paper surface, and excellent ink absorption performance, which is comparable to that of pure white paper. It has been deeply loved by the calligraphy and painting circles since its birth. "

"The top-grade Lianshi paper is the best. Smooth as oil, warm and moist Ruyu is known as the "Thousand-Year-Old Paper". After the Kangxi period of the Qing Dynasty, this kind of paper was used more frequently. "Zhengyitang Shu" and so on, have all adopted This kind of bamboo paper was used during the Republic of China period. The Shanghai Commercial Press and Zhonghua Book Company commonly used 'superior continuous history paper' to print books. The seals of Hangzhou Xiling Seal Society were also made of this kind of continuous history paper. .”

"This first-class continuous history paper was called 'Taishi Lian' during the Kangxi Dynasty." Easily misunderstood and confused.”

"In fact, the three types of paper have completely different values. In the Tongbai Shanfang Festival edition of "The Book of Rites and Huiyuan" engraved in the spring of the 52nd year of Qianlong's reign, there is a vermilion wooden mark in the upper left corner of the title page, and there is a sentence - 'Lian Four pieces of white paper cost three dollars each Lufen and Taishi bamboo paper each cost 2 yuan. This means that the same edition of the book printed on four-piece paper is nearly one-third more expensive than the one printed on Taishi paper."

"And. Books from Kangxi and Qian dynasties printed with "Taishilian", Usually they are the 'national edition', which is even more valuable."

"Look at it, there are three kinds of paper here. It is obvious that the previous collectors regarded them as the same type. ”
